By MyFM’s Claire Beverly – The Franklin Town Council has reportedly agreed to cut the town budget by more than a million dollars and move that money to the school district. In a meeting Wednesday night with a packed agenda that did not end until well after midnight, the town council made the budget move following public comment over potential school cuts following a failed tax override vote. Franklin Matters reports that the council also agreed in principle to use about a million dollars from the town’s and school district’s rainy-day funds.
